Films Of Asia For TV

Films of life in Hong Kong, northern India, Indonesia, and Papua may soon be seen on television in Christchurch as a result of a two-month tour of Asia by Mr G. L. Crozier, head of the publicity department of the Presbyterian Church, who returned from his assignment to Christchurch last evening.

With a New Zealand colleague, Mr Crozier took both moving and still documentary films of both city and countrylife in Asia. The films showed the various social, educational, and medical contributions made to the life of the people by the indigenous churches, and the participation of New Zealand people in the work of such churches, said Mr Crozier last evening. The still pictures taken would be used in church publications in New Zealand, and in the making of filmstrips, he said.
